Pusoy is a 13-card game played by four players using a standard 52-card deck. Each player arranges their 13 cards into three hands: a 3-card front hand, a 5-card middle hand, and a 5-card back hand. The challenge is that each hand must outrank the one in front of it — so you can't just dump your best cards in one pile. You have to think several steps ahead, and that's exactly what makes it so satisfying to win.

Pusoy Hand Rankings – From Weakest to Strongest

Before you sit down at a table on top646ph, make sure you know what beats what. These are the standard hand rankings used across all Pusoy tables on the platform.

1

High Card

No combination formed. The highest single card in the hand determines its value. The weakest possible hand.

2

One Pair

Two cards of the same rank. Common in both the front and middle hands for beginner players.

3

Two Pair

Two separate pairs. Usually placed in the middle hand to balance card distribution.

4

Three of a Kind

Three cards sharing the same rank. A strong front hand when you're lucky enough to have it.

5

Straight

Five cards in sequential rank, any suits. A-2-3-4-5 is the lowest; 10-J-Q-K-A is the highest.

6

Flush

Five cards all of the same suit, non-sequential. Suit ranking: Spades > Hearts > Clubs > Diamonds.

7

Full House

Three of a kind plus a pair. A very strong back hand that's difficult for opponents to beat.

8

Four of a Kind

Four cards of the same rank. Rare and powerful — almost always wins the back position.

9

Straight Flush / Royal Flush

Five sequential cards of the same suit. Royal Flush (10-J-Q-K-A same suit) is the absolute best hand.

Quick Reminder: In Pusoy, your back hand must always be stronger than your middle hand, and your middle hand must always be stronger than your front hand. Misset your hands and you automatically lose all three comparisons — even if your cards were great. top646ph's interface helps flag invalid arrangements before you confirm.

Pusoy Strategy Tips That Actually Work

Pusoy rewards patience and planning over impulse. If you're just stuffing your strongest cards into the back hand without thinking about the front and middle, you're leaving wins on the table. Here are the habits that separate disciplined players from those who bust out early.

Balance All Three Hands

Don't dump everything into your back hand. A weak front or middle hand means your opponent wins at least one position automatically. Spread the strength across all three as evenly as the cards allow.

Watch the Cards Your Opponents Need

Pay attention to what hands have been revealed in previous rounds. If three Aces have shown up already, no one's hiding the fourth. This helps you assess how strong your current hand actually is in context.

Use the Front Hand Wisely

New players often treat the 3-card front hand as leftover cards. Don't. A strong front hand (like three of a kind) that wins its comparison is worth exactly as much as winning the back hand.

Don't Rush the Clock

top646ph gives you adequate time to arrange your hands. Use it. Rushed arrangement is the most common reason players accidentally set their hands in an invalid configuration and auto-lose the round.

Start at Lower Stakes Tables

If you're new to online Pusoy, begin at the minimum-stake tables. The opponents are less aggressive, and you get to practice arrangement strategy without risking large amounts of pesos.
